News Wrap: California seeks to rename César Chavez Day

Season 2026 Episode 60 | 5m 00s

In our news wrap Thursday, California is seeking to rename César Chavez Day following allegations the late labor leader sexually assaulted women and girls, small airports in the U.S. may have to close if the partial government shutdown continues and Democratic-led states are suing the Trump administration over its decision to repeal a scientific finding central to the fight against climate change.
